本文介紹SQL 語句中 group by 和聚合函數的用法 閱讀目錄 group by 用法的概述 “Group By” 就是根據“By”指定的規則對數據進行分組,所謂的分組就是將一個“數據集”划分成若干個“小區域”,然后針對若干個“小區域”進行數據處理。 Score表 上篇 ...
本文轉載於https: blog.csdn.net shaofei article details 為什么不能夠select from Table group by id,為什么一定不能是 ,而是某一個列或者某個列的聚合函數,group by 多個字段可以怎么去很好的理解呢 不過最后還是轉過來了,簡單寫寫吧,大牛們直接略過吧。 先來看表 : 表 執行如下SQL語句: SELECT name FRO ...
2020-04-24 17:30 0 2411 推薦指數:
本文介紹SQL 語句中 group by 和聚合函數的用法 閱讀目錄 group by 用法的概述 “Group By” 就是根據“By”指定的規則對數據進行分組,所謂的分組就是將一個“數據集”划分成若干個“小區域”,然后針對若干個“小區域”進行數據處理。 Score表 上篇 ...
1.在使用 GROUP BY 子句時,Select列表中的所有列必須是聚合列(SUM,MIN/MAX,AVG等)或是GROUP BY 子句中包括的列。同樣,如果在SELECT 列表中使用聚合列,SELECT列表必須只包括聚合列,否則必須有一個GROUP BY 子句。例如: 2. ...
原文 很多時候單獨使用聚合函數的時候覺得很容易,求個平均值,求和,求個數等,但是和分組一起用就有點混淆了,好記性不如爛筆頭,所以就記下來以后看看。 常用聚合函數羅列 1 AVG() - 返回平均值 ...
。 聚合函數經常與 SELECT 語句的 GROUP BY 子句一同使用。 所有聚合函數都具有確 ...
聚合函數:聚合函數就是對一組值進行計算后返回單個值。 包括: COUNT(統計函數);COUNT_BIG(統計函數);SUM(求和函數);AVG(求平均值函數);MAX(最大值函數);MIN(最小值函數);STDEV(標准偏差值函數);VAR(方差值函數);HAVING(HAVING子句僅用 ...
1、當聚集函數和非聚集函數出現在一起時,需要將非聚集函數進行group by2、當只做聚集函數查詢時候,就不需要進行分組了。 ...
1.在oracle中 select * from Table group by id 會報錯。 會報不是group by 表達式。為什么一定不能是 * ,而必須是分組的列或者某個列的聚合函數。 在mysql中不會出現這樣的問題。原因如下: 1.新建測試表test:表一 執行如下SQL ...
group by 和聚合函數使用:每組返回一個統計值 partition by 和聚合函數使用:每組每行返回一個統計值,通常配合row_number排序函數使用 一、在group by后的結果集上使用聚合函數,會作用在分組下的所有記錄上。 group by 還有一個隱藏的功能:去重(求和時需要 ...